Zend Core for Oracle 2.0 Released
Zend have just released a new version of Zend Core for Oracle. This is a prebuilt and tested stack of Apache, PHP and Oracle Instant Client. If you haven't used it before, you will like the easy setup. I promise.

Zend Core for Oracle release 2.0 includes PHP 5.2.1, the refactored OCI8 driver, Oracle Instant Client, and an optional Apache HTTP Server 2.2.2.
Zend Core for Oracle is supported by Zend on the following operating systems:
* Oracle Enterprise Linux
* X86 running SLES9 or RHEL3 or RHEL4
* X86 running Windows XP/2003/Vista
* X86-64 running Windows Vista in 32bit mode
* X86-64 running SLES9 or RHEL3 or RHEL4
* pSeries running AIX 5.2 or 5.3
* Sun Solaris Sparc 8, 9 10
The web servers that are supported are:
* Apache 1.3.x (except on Windows Vista), Apache 2.x
* Oracle HTTP Server 10.1.2.0.0 (on Linux and Windows x86)
* Microsoft IIS 5, 6, 7
Zend Core for Oracle is supported (by Zend) against Oracle Database 10g and 9i. That means that you can have a fully supported stack of database, web server and PHP.
